Juglans sigillata, known as the iron walnut, is a species of walnut tree. The tree has been cultivated for its edible nuts. The nuts are oval-shaped with bumps and ridges. The tree is also used for its wood. It is commonly found in Yunnan, but are also found in Guizhou, Sichuan and Xizang in China. It is sometimes grown in gardens and parks as an ornamental plant.

Walnut grafting method

The invention belongs to the technical field of fruit tree grafting, and particularly relates to a walnut grafting method. The walnut grafting method comprises the following steps: S1, rootstock selection; S2, scion selection and collection; S3, rootstock treatment; S4, scion treatment, S5, grafting; S6, management after grafting. In the grafting method, juglans sigillata which has high affinity and strong growth and adapts to subtropical climate is taken as a rootstock, so that the survival rate of grafting is increased; cut scion branches are placed at a shady place for 5 to 10 hours, so that tannin substances in the branches flow out, and the content of the tannin substances in the scion branches is reduced; the rootstock is scratched before grafting, so that the content of the tannin substances in the rootstock is reduced; during grafting, a composite plant growth regulating agent is sprayed onto a notch of the rootstock, and scions are dipped into the composite plant growth regulating agent, so that the formation of healing tissues is facilitated. By adopting the method provided by the invention, the survival rate of walnut grafting is increased remarkably, and the walnut grafting survival rate is up to 97 percent.

Method for crushing purely natural wild juglans sigillata and separating kernels from shells

The invention discloses a method for crushing purely natural wild juglans sigillata and separating kernels from shells. The method comprises the following steps of performing soaking: placing the juglans sigillata in clean water for soaking so as to obtain soaked juglans sigillata; performing crushing: placing the soaked juglans sigillata into a crushing machine for crushing so as to obtain crushed juglans sigillata granules of which kernels and shells are mixed; performing classifying: placing the crushed juglans sigillata granules of which the kernels and the shells are mixed into a sorting machine for sorting so as to obtain large crushed juglans sigillata granules on a sieve and small crushed juglans sigillata granules under the sieve; performing drying: performing drying treatment on the small crushed juglans sigillata granules under the sieve so as to obtain dried juglans sigillata granules of which the kernels and the shells are mixed; and performing kernel-shell separation: placing the dried juglans sigillata granules of which the kernels and the shells are mixed in a color selector for color selection separation so as to obtain separated juglans sigillata shells and juglans sigillata kernels. The method for crushing purely natural wild juglans sigillata and separating kernels the shells is simple in technology, safe, environmentally-friendly, convenient and high-efficient.

Semi-annual walnut stock and cultivating method of semi-annual stock walnut seedlings

The invention discloses a walnut semi-annual stock and a cultivating method of semi-annual stock walnut seedlings, belonging to the technical field of forest cultivation. The cultivating method of the semi-annual walnut stock comprises the following steps of: with same year seeds of a Sigillate walnut seedling tree as seeds for stock cultivation, treating the seeds, sowing the seeds into a ground bed in autumn in the same year, covering mulching films and constructing a plastic film arched shed, and controlling the temperature in the shed to 16-20 DEG C before euphylla of the seedlings is expanded, covering a sunshade net with the light transmittance of being 20-30 percent, wherein the soil water content is 40-50 percent; and after the euphylla of the seedlings is expanded and before graft is carried out in February and March of the next year, controlling the temperature in the shed to 15-25 DEG C, the light transmittance of the sunshade net to 40-60 percent and the soil water content to 40-60 percent. The semi-annual stock cultivated by using the cultivating method is used for cultivating the semi-annual stock walnut tree seedlings through grafting. The cultivating method disclosed by the invention is short in cultivation time, the average outplanting rate of the walnut seedlings is up to 87.7 percent which is increased by 25.5-67.4 percent in contrast, and the seedling raising cost is reduced in comparison with that of a bud stock.

Juglans sigillata oil squeezing process capable of effectively improving oil yield

The invention discloses a juglans sigillata oil squeezing process capable of effectively improving the oil yield. The process comprises the following steps: 1) pre-treatment, namely firstly, dividing juglans sigillata to be oil-squeezed into five parts equally, and sectioning 0.5-2 parts thereof by two cuts to separate out juglans sigillata kernels; cutting the residual juglans sigillata to be oil-squeezed in a square shape, wherein the weight ratio of the residual walnut shells and the walnut kernels is (1-1.5) to 10, drying the mixture, then primarily crushing and screening the mixture, removing coarse shells, and crushing the mixture again to obtain juglans sigillata powder; uniformly mixing the juglans sigillata powder with the juglans sigillata kernels to obtain a raw material to be oil-squeezed; 2) low-temperature cold squeezing, namely performing low-temperature cold squeezing for 2-4 times on the raw material to be oil-squeezed pretreated in the step (1) to obtain crude oil; and 3) post treatment, namely precipitating, filtering and purifying the obtained crude oil to obtain the juglans sigillata oil. The oil squeezing process disclosed by the invention is capable of reserving nutritional components in walnut oil, and is stable in quality and high in oil yield, and the obtained juglans sigillata oil is clear in color and rich in nutrition.

Production method of walnut oil and produced walnut oil

The invention discloses a production method of walnut oil and the produced walnut oil. Annual wild Juglans sigillata Dode is selected, rotten wild Juglans sigillata Dode is removed, and the surface of the wild Juglans sigillata Dode is cleaned and sterilized; the wild Juglans sigillata Dode is dried, cooled and broken by a breaker, and hull and walnut kernels are separated; the walnut kernels are placed in an alkaline liquid and peeled for 8-30 min, fished out, cleaned with clear water and dried at the temperature lower than or equal to 50 DEG C until the water content is smaller than or equal to 3%; the walnut kernels are smashed and fed into a hydraulic presser, and crude oil and oil dreg are obtained through solid-liquid separation; the crude oil is subjected to hydration, deacidification, washing, discoloration, filtration, deodorization and filtration, and the finished product, namely, refined walnut oil, is obtained. The acidity of the produced walnut oil is smaller than or equal to 0.5, the wild walnut oil tastes good, pure original fruit aroma of the wild walnut oil is kept, no rancidity is produced, freshness is kept, saturated fatty acid, linolenic acid and linoleic acid are increased, the walnut oil is difficult to oxidize, nutrition is locked and the like. The preparation process is simple, easy to operate, low in production cost, high in oil yield and suitable for industrial production.

Bleeding sap releasing green-branch grafting method for juglans sigillata in plateau

The invention relates to a bleeding sap releasing green-branch grafting method for juglans sigillata in a plateau, and belongs to the technical field of development of forestry walnut industry and therelated technical field. The method specifically comprises the following steps: step 1, performing scion selection of a target variety: selecting a semi-lignified healthy and robust growing branch, and cutting off tender leaves for standby application; step 2, performing grafting: opening a small groove with a length of 2-3 cm and a width of 0.2-0.5 cm in a connection position of a scion and a rootstock, or bundling a small stick with a length of 3-5 cm and a diameter of 0.2-0.3 cm to draw out bleeding sap of a tree body, and performing bandaging; and step 3, performing daily management. Themethod provided by the invention selects semi-lignified growing branch new shoots, releases the bleeding sap of the tree body (grooving and releasing sap), can improve a grafting survival rate by 25%or more, can make up for the defect that grafting is performed again in a next year because grafting does not succeed in spring of a current year, completes grafting transformation a year earlier, improves quality, increases benefits, and can obtain huge economic benefits.

Method for ecologically planting angelica decursiva in juglans sigillata forest

The invention discloses a method for ecologically planting angelica decursiva in a juglans sigillata forest, and belongs to the technical field of traditional Chinese medicine planting. The method sequentially includes the following steps of firstly, selecting a land and preparing soil, wherein the juglans sigillata forest in a cold and wet area with altitude of 2500 m to 3000 m and gradient of 3 degrees to 30 degrees is selected for planting, juglans sigillata tree age ranges from 5 years to 6 years, and the spacing in rows and spacing between rows of juglans sigillata are 6 m*8 m; secondly, sowing seeds, wherein 2-2.5 kg of angelica decursiva seeds are sown per mu, sowing in lines is adopted in the sowing process, lines are pulled and bottom channels are flattened through shoveling during sowing in lines, channel depth is 3 cm, and the line spacing ranges from 30 cm to 35 cm; thirdly, conducting field management, wherein weeding, topdressing of hole applied fertilizer, seed stack picking and topping, stamen removing, drought resisting and waterlogging preventing are conducted; fourthly, harvesting angelica decursiva. Appropriate growth conditions can be provided for angelica decursiva, land in the juglans sigillata forest can be used for plantation, weeding is achieved for juglans sigillata, juglans sigillata planting cost is reduced, and dual income increase is achieved through juglans sigillata and angelica decursiva.

Method for producing virgin walnut oil by utilizing juglans sigillata

The invention discloses a method for producing virgin walnut oil by utilizing juglans sigillata. The method comprises the following steps: removing rotten fruits and diseased fruits of the juglans sigillata; after immersing with clean water, washing through a spraying type brush roller washing machine; drying walnuts through hot air at low temperature by adopting a gradient interval manner; separating shells and kernels by applying a rice polishing mill; separating to obtain kernel powder with a few of walnut kernels; covering the walnut kernel powder with oil cloth and conveying into a hydraulic oil press for pressing; then conveying meal into a spiral oil press and further pressing to obtain light yellow walnut oil; carrying out secondary filtering through a self-heating type plate-and-frame filtering machine, so as to obtain high-quality walnut oil. The method disclosed by the invention has the advantages of low production equipment cost, high efficiency and strong applicability; the oil residual rate of the meal is lower than 5 percent and the prepared walnut oil has a light yellow color and a rich walnut aroma; the acid value of the walnut oil is less than 0.8mg / g, and the content of copper, iron, arsenic, lead, aflatoxin B1, benzo(a) pyrene and the like is in a range required by national standards, so that the method is applicable to industrial production.

Moisture-preserving and water-draining juglans sigillata grafting method

The invention relates to a fruit tree grafting technology, in particular to a juglans sigillata grafting method. The moisture-preserving and water-draining juglans sigillata grafting method comprises the following steps: cutting off a stock trunk, cutting a fracture into an inclined surface, cutting notches in the bark layer of the stock, and cutting juglans sigillata scions to form steep slope surfaces and gentle slope surfaces; inserting the scions into the notches of the stock for jointing, arranging at least two drainage sticks between the two scions, and enabling the top ends of the drainage sticks to be located between the fracture height of the stock and the top end height of the scions; and binding the joints of the scions and the stock and the drainage sticks with plastic films to expose the top ends of the scions and the drainage sticks, enabling plastic bags to penetrate through top ends of the scions to cover the top ends of the drainage sticks, and sealing the openings of the plastic bags and the top ends of the scions with the plastic films to complete grafting. After grafting, whether water is accumulated on the grafting joints is continuously checked, water drainage measures are taken, grafting work can be completed through one-time operation, water drainage preparation before grafting and subsequent management after grafting are omitted, the method is simple and convenient, and the survival rate of the scions is high.

Auricularia polytricha culture medium containing juglans sigillata sawdust and preparation method thereof

The invention belongs to the technical field of edible fungus cultivation, and discloses an auricularia polytricha cultivation medium containing juglans sigillata wood chips and a preparation method thereof, the auricularia polytricha cultivation medium containing juglans sigillata wood chips comprises, by weight, 1-77 parts of juglans sigillata wood chips, 77-1 part of hard weed tree wood chips, 20 parts of wheat bran, 1 part of lime and 1 part of gypsum. The prepared culture medium of the auricularia polytricha variety containing the juglans sigillata sawdust can improve the yield and the biological conversion rate of the auricularia polytricha and improve the content of polysaccharide, potassium, calcium, magnesium, boron, sulfur and zinc in sporocarp. According to the auricularia polytricha cultivated through the formula, the biological conversion rate reaches 110.60%, the yield is increased by 10.24%, the polysaccharide content in sporocarp is increased by 44.16%, the potassium content is increased by 11.07%, the calcium content is increased by 47.50%, the magnesium content is increased by 35.62%, the boron content is increased by 19.36%, the sulfur content is increased by 3.79%, and the zinc content is increased by 46.02%.

Yangbi Dapao walnut ribonuclease gene jsrnase and its application

The invention discloses a Juglans sigillata Dode ribonuclease gene JsRNase and application thereof. The nucleotide sequence of the JsRNase gene is disclosed as SEQ ID NO:1. According to the coding ribonuclease, the research by functional genomics related technology confirms that the JsRNase gene has the function of enhancing fungus infection resistance of the plant. After the antifungal JsRNase gene is constructed into a plant expression vector and transformed into tobacco for overexpression, the transgenic tobacco plant has very high in-vitro antifungal activity. The JsRNase-overexpressed transgenic tobacco has obvious inhibiting actions on growth of Colletotrichum gloeosporioides, Sclerotinia sclerotiorum, Fusarium oxysporum and Gibberella moniliformis.

Self-propelled mechanical reciprocating soaked walnut harvester

The invention discloses a self-propelled mechanical reciprocating juglans sigillata dode harvester which is composed of a power output mechanism, a supporting power lifting mechanism, a reciprocating motion switching device, a guide device and a clamping device. The self-propelled mechanical reciprocating juglans sigillata dode harvester is applicable to one-time harvest of juglans sigillata dode plants with the trunk diameter at breast height less than or equal to 320mm and fruit maturity not less than 80%; during harvest, the juglans sigillata dode trunks are fixed with the clamping device at the breast height position of the juglans sigillata dode trunks, the harvester is started, and harvesting of juglans sigillata dode fruits of one single plant with the diameter at breast height less than 320mm is completed at one time within 20 seconds; the harvest rate reaches above 98.7%, and harvesting efficiency is more than 90 times of that of artificial harvesting.

Application of bubble walnut shell extract in the preparation of antitumor drugs

The invention discloses application of juglans sigillata shell extractive in preparation of antitumor drugs, and relates to the application of juglans sigillata shell extractive for preparing drugs for preventing and treating tumor diseases. More specifically, the invention relates to an effective part obtained by steeping juglans sigillata shells in aqueous alkali and medical application thereof for preparing the antitumor drugs. The juglans sigillata shell is the shell of ripe juglans sigillata belonging to juglans of juglandaceae, the effective part extractive has significant effect on inhibiting viability of human lung cancer cells and human hepatoma carcinoma cells, and has very small virulence to normal human hepatocytes, thus being expected to be made into the drugs for preventing and treating various tumor diseases.

Thinning, crown-reducing and abundance-promoting pruning method for juglans siggillata

The invention discloses a thinning, crown-reducing and abundance-promoting pruning method for juglans siggillata. The thinning, crown-removing and abundance-promoting pruning method for juglans siggillata comprises the following steps of observing and remaining branches, sawing off miscellaneous branches, cutting off diseased branches, protecting wounds and the like. The method can remove inner bore upright branches, enables a round-head tree to form a bowl shape, and promotes large branches to germinate and bear fruits inside, outside, above and below. The method is mainly used for implementing a big branch pruning technology for reducing crowns, opening angles of large branches and correcting tree body skeletons for adult juglans sigillata and is used for solving problems of inter-row closing, inter-plant closing and inner bore closing of a walnut orchard and promoting three-dimensional fruiting of the crowns. The labor-saving pruning method focuses on sawing off overdense large branches influencing illumination of an inner bore at a middle part and an upper part of a tree crow, forms an open tree shape changed from convex to concave, improves ventilation and light transmission of a tree body and promotes vertical fruiting of the whole tree.
